    For my recent visit to Peter Chang's weekend Bottomless Dim Sum and Tapas Brunch, I prepared by:…read more * Fasting for 12 hours * A one hour gym workout * Two hours playing pickleball Met up with my immediate family to celebrate Mother's Day this past weekend, and I gotta say, this brunch is one of the better AYCE deals currently in NOVA. Located off of busy Centreville Road in Herndon, DMV legendary restaurateur Peter Chang opened this latest establishment in September 2024. Reservations are HIGHLY recommended for their Bottomless weekend brunch; and especially if you have a large group, as we did. There is limited parking right in front, but drive a bit further for a larger lot across the street within a 2-3 min walk. The interior is modern with the familiar high ceilings, exposed duct work, faux greenery, and Asian themed artwork. Combined with the choice of almost tropical like tables and chairs, the decor was giving off serious Malaysia vibes. When our server arrived, she explained that diners could choose items from EITHER the Chinese Tapas or Traditional Dim Sum menu, which is awesome since this allows for the culinary options of over 45+ items!!! Depending on the size of your group, I would suggest ordering 6-8 items at a time, since the plates are small (about a 1-2 person serving size). And TBH, I like this style of AYCE as opposed to the the usual long steam tables of food which just sits underneath heat lamps, and has tongs which have been handled by lots of people...yuck! And for the restaurant, it helps to limit food waste. Over the next 90 minutes (time limit for the AYCE brunch), we sampled so many items, but some of the standouts were: * Crystal Shrimp Dumpling (har gow) - wrapper wasn't too thick, and the shrimp filling was plentiful and had excellent flavor * Steamed pork and shrimp shu mai - very good version of a dim sum staple. * Beef Chow Fun - noodles could've had more "wok hei" flavor, but beef was tender and not too salty. * Soup Dumplings (Xiao Long Bao) - good amount of seasoned soup inside the wrapper with tasty pork filling * Salt and pepper shrimp - peeled shrimp was flash fried, but not rubbery. It was topped with a salty peppery crunchy topping. We had several rounds of this dish. * Black Sesame egg yolk bao - creamy and not too sweet eggy filling, inside the soft black sesame bao I will detract one star for the service, however. Im my estimation, the place is understaffed for the volume of customers. Water and tea was a bit slow to arrive (after 8 min of sitting down) and it was challening to flag down our server to order more items; hence the reason it's recommended to get multiple dishes at one time. But at the end of the meal, everyone was quite pleased and satisfied, most importantly, mom and dad enjoyed the experience. When the check arrived, our party of 10 had ordered 40 items. With tax and tip, the total came out to a tad under $400. Tbh, for the quality and variety of food, $40/person is a good deal. I can definitely envision Peter Chang's weekend bottomless brunch being a monthly occurrence for me.

    Chau's Cafe has been on and off my radar these past few years. When I saw that Yelp friend, Lyn L…read more went there recently and gave them high marks, we decided to give them a try. Be prepared to hunt for the place if you've never been to the shopping center, which is quite close to Route 7. We were here around 4 p.m. on a Saturday. At that time of day, there was one occupied table. Ordering food means going to the counter and giving your order to the person working there, and then paying. They have a menu on the wall, but the woman working there told us to look at the paper menu. Apparently, the menu on the wall is constantly changing. Before coming, we decided to order Mongolian beef, ma po tofu, and two small bowls of hot and sour soup. At first, my husband couldn't find the Mongolian beef on the menu. I took a look and found it is listed under the chef's specials. We gave our order and also got a can of ginger ale from the refrigerated chest. After paying, we chose a four top table for ourselves. The food came out quickly! First, the hot and sour soup came. It was served hot and did have some kick to it. We both enjoyed it. It does have quite a few button mushrooms in it, which I gave to my husband. Just as we were finishing the soup, both our entrees arrived. We both liked the Mongolian beef (which also had an abundance of button mushrooms). The sauce was tasty, and the beef was tender. As for the ma po tofu, we thought it was okay but could have been better. It's a meat-free entree that basically has large pieces of tofu, a lot of thin, spicy sauce, and bits of green onions. We each were given generous portions of white rice. We would consider visiting again in the future, as the service was excellent. As for ambiance, it has a carry-out place feel. It's kept quite clean.
